Albarado rode to victory in the 2003 Jockey Club Gold Cup aboard U.S. Horse of the Year, Mineshaft. He has ridden in eight Kentucky Derbys with his best results coming on third-place finishers Steppenwolfer in 2006 and Curlin in 2007. He also rode Steppenwolfer to a fourth-place finish in the Belmont Stakes.
He is the regular jockey for the 3-year-old colt Curlin who was the favorite and finished third in the 2007 Kentucky Derby. Albarado won his first Triple Crown race at the 2007 Preakness Stakes aboard Curlin, edging out Derby-winner Street Sense. Albarado was denied victory at the 2007 Belmont Stakes when Curlin lost to champion filly Rags to Riches by a nose. Albarado also won the 2007 Breeder's Cup Classic aboard Curlin, which was his first Breeder's Cup win.
Robby Albarado was voted the 2004 George Woolf Memorial Jockey Award. That year, on December the 8th, he picked up his 3,000 career win riding Isle of Silver to victory at the Fair Grounds Race Course in New Orleans.
